What is the significance of the Planck time?

A) It is the amount of time required for two protons to fuse to make deuterium.
B) It is the time at which inflation is thought to have occurred.
C) It is the time when the cosmic microwave background was released.
D) Before it, conditions were so extreme that our current understanding of physics is insufficient to predict what might have occurred.


D
